Bill Bowman
BornWilliam M. Bowman
March 18, 1883
DiedAugust 01, 1984 (age 101)
Seattle, Washington

Bill Bowman (b.1883-d.1984) served as the first president of The Seattle Ring, Number 59 of the International Brotherhood of Magicians, which began meeting on March 16, 1931.
